Applicant: FUJIFILM Corporation
Inventor: Ryuji SANETO , Yohei HAMACHI , Kenta MIYAHARA
Abstract: An object of the present invention is to provide an optical laminate that can be used for a reflective circular polarizer with little occurrence of a ghost in a case of being used in a virtual reality display device, an electronic finder, or the like, a laminated optical film including the reflective circular polarizer, an optical article including the optical laminate, and a virtual reality display device including the optical article.
The optical laminate according to the embodiment of the present invention includes, in the following order, a first layer, a second layer, a third layer, and a fourth layer, in which all of the first layer to the fourth layer are cholesteric liquid crystal layers, all of the first layer to the fourth layer have light reflectivity, a central wavelength of reflected light of the first layer is within a range of 430 to 570 nm, a central wavelength of reflected light of the second layer is within a range of 550 to 670 nm, a central wavelength of reflected light of the third layer is within a range of 430 to 570 nm, a central wavelength of reflected light of the fourth layer is within a range of 550 to 670 nm, a sign of a retardation of the first layer in a film thickness direction at a wavelength of 550 nm and a sign of a retardation of the second layer in a film thickness direction at a wavelength of 550 nm are opposite to each other, and a sign of a retardation of the third layer in a film thickness direction at a wavelength of 550 nm and a sign of a retardation of the fourth layer in a film thickness direction at a wavelength of 550 nm are opposite to each other.
